"Australian sentenced to 500 lashes in Saudi Arabia," from AFP, December 7 (thanks to all who sent this in):



An Australian man has been sentenced to 500 lashes and a year in jail by a court in Saudi Arabia after being found guilty of blasphemy, Canberra said on Wednesday.

Reports said Mansor Almaribe, 45, was detained in the city of Medina on November 14 while making the hajj pilgrimage and accused of insulting companions of the prophet Mohammed.



Australia's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ade said he was sentenced on Tuesday and Canberra's ambassador in Saudi Arabia had been in touch with authorities to plead for leniency....



A consular official attended the sentencing, where the Shiite Muslim was initially slapped with a two-year jail term that was subsequently reduced, the spokeswoman added....



His eldest son, Jamal, told the newspaper this week that his father had been reading and praying in a group when accosted by religious police and arrested....
